1976 Chrysler 1609 vs. 1971 Rover 2000

To start off, 1976 Chrysler 1609 is newer by 5 year(s). Which means there will be less support and parts availability for 1971 Rover 2000. In addition, the cost of maintenance, including insurance, on 1971 Rover 2000 would be higher. At 2,007 cc (4 cylinders), 1976 Chrysler 1609 is equipped with a bigger engine. In terms of performance, 1971 Rover 2000 (106 HP @ 5500 RPM) has 42 more horse power than 1976 Chrysler 1609. (64 HP @ 4000 RPM) In normal driving conditions, 1971 Rover 2000 should accelerate faster than 1976 Chrysler 1609. With that said, vehicle weight also plays an important factor in acceleration. 1971 Rover 2000 weights approximately 75 kg more than 1976 Chrysler 1609. So despite on having greater horse power, its additional weight may have an impact towards its acceleration in comparison.

Both vehicles are rear wheel drive (RWD) - it offers better handling in dry conditions; in addition, if you are looking to drift, both vehicles do the job better than front wheel drive vehicles. With that said, do keep in mind that many other factors such as speed and the wear on your tires can also have significant impact on traction and control. Let's talk about torque, 1971 Rover 2000 (172 Nm @ 3750 RPM) has 42 more torque (in Nm) than 1976 Chrysler 1609. (130 Nm @ 2100 RPM). This means 1971 Rover 2000 will have an easier job in driving up hills or pulling heavy equipment than 1976 Chrysler 1609.

Compare all specifications:

1976 Chrysler 1609 1971 Rover 2000
Make Chrysler Rover
Model 1609 2000
Year Released 1976 1971
Engine Position Front Front
Engine Size 2007 cc 1978 cc
Engine Cylinders 4 cylinders 4 cylinders
Engine Type in-line in-line
Horse Power 64 HP 106 HP
Engine RPM 4000 RPM 5500 RPM
Torque 130 Nm 172 Nm
Torque RPM 2100 RPM 3750 RPM
Fuel Type Diesel Gasoline
Drive Type Rear Rear
Transmission Type Manual Manual
Number of Seats 5 seats 5 seats
Vehicle Weight 1220 kg 1295 kg
Vehicle Length 4530 mm 4550 mm
Vehicle Width 1740 mm 1690 mm
Vehicle Height 1450 mm 1400 mm
Wheelbase Size 2670 mm 2640 mm
